新烟碱类杀虫剂呋虫胺对褐飞虱的防效及安全性评价

摘要
为了明确新烟碱类杀虫剂呋虫胺对水稻褐飞虱的防治效果及其对水稻及其天敌拟水狼蛛的安全性.本研究通过室内作物安全性试验,测定了呋虫胺对水稻的安全性;采用浸渍法,测定了呋虫胺对褐飞虱和拟水狼蛛的毒力,并进行了田间药效试验.室内毒力测定表明,呋虫胺对水稻褐飞虱的LC50和LC90分别为0.761 0和4.305 5mg/L,对天敌拟水狼蛛表现一定低风险,安全系数为5.443 3;安全性评估试验表明,20%呋虫胺悬浮剂喷施后水稻未出现药害,对水稻生长没有抑制作用;大田防效的试验表明,20%呋虫胺悬浮剂推荐剂量的防效高于350g/L吡虫啉悬浮剂推荐剂量的防效,施药后1d防效达到80%以上,施药后7d防效达到90%以上.综上所述,呋虫胺对水稻褐飞虱的防治效果好,对作物安全,对天敌拟水狼蛛低风险.
Abstract
To determinethe control effect of dinotefuran on rice planthopper and evaluate its safety on rice and natural enemies.The safety of dinotefuran on rice was determined by laboratory tests.The toxicity on nilaparvata lugens and pirata subparaticus was determined and the field efficacy trials were conducted.The results showed that LC50 and LC90 of dinotefuran on nilaparvata lugens were 0.761 0mg/L and 4.305 5mg/L respectively,and that dinotefuran showed less risk to pirata subparaticus with the safety factor of 5.443 3.The safety assessment tests showed dinotefuran 20% SC presented no phototoxicity and inhibitory effect on rice.The results of field experiments showed,when compared with imidacloprid 350g/L SC,dinotefuran 20% SC had higher control effectat the recommended application rate.The control effects of dinotefuranreached above 80% 1d after application and above 90% 7d after application.The amount ofpirata subparaticus decreased obviously in paddy field after applying the product.Therefore,it was concluded that dinotefuran had good control effect on nilaparvata lugens and was safety to rice and showed less risk to pirata subparaticus.
